> I have started making familiar myself with TCP/IP
> Programming in Linux. I am interested in learing
> TCP/IP Stack Programming in Linux and how could I
I suggest you go over to your book dealer and ask him for "Stevens,
W. Richard: Unix Network Programming, Volume 1: Networking APIs: Sockets
and XTI".
> modify a TCP/IP stack to meet my requirements.
Most probably, that's not needed at all.
> Could anyone suggest me a book on TCP/IP Stack
> Programming in C/C++ ?
